An explanation based on many observations supported by experimental results is called a scientific theory. A scientific theory synthesizes a wide range of evidence and provides a coherent framework for understanding phenomena. It is continually tested and refined as new data emerges, distinguishing it from a hypothesis, which is a preliminary explanation that has yet to be extensively tested.

Observations and measurements made during an experiment are called the data.
The data collected during an experiment is called experimental data. It consists of observations, measurements, or information gathered during the experimental process to analyze and draw conclusions.
Observations and measurements recorded during an experiment are called results. These results can help to make a conclusion or theory or become the object of further study.
A unifying explanation for a broad range of hypotheses and observations that have been supported by testing is called a theory. Theories are well-established explanations that integrate and explain various facts and observations in a field of study. They serve as a framework for understanding and predicting phenomena.
